Thatcher Demko is one of the early frontrunners for the Vezina Trophy this season, but his toughest competition may be within his division.
Two months into the season, Demko is near the top of the league in wins, save percentage and goals-against average and is number one in the league regarding goals saved above expected (GSAx).
Travis Yost says that Demko is certainly an early favourite for the Vezina Trophy, but his division rivals are perhaps his stiffest competition.
He points to strong early season performances from Vegas' Adin Hill and LA's Cam Talbot, and the underrated comeback play of both John Gibson and Jacob Markstrom.
Yost says with Demko leading the pack, the Vezina Trophy looks most likely to land in the Pacific Division.
The odds of this year's Vezina Trophy winner coming from the PAcific are far greater than where they were just two months ago,
Yost writes.
Demko will have to continue his stellar play throughout the season if he hopes to secure his first Vezina Trophy as league's top goalie.
